Rhytiphora sellata

Rhytiphora sellata is the scientific name of a group of Lamiinae -also called lamiines or flat-faced longhorned beetles-


Rhytiphora sellata (Breuning, 1938)

S. Breuning is the author of the original taxon.

Rhytiphora sellata (Breuning, 1938) is the full name of the group-species in the taxonomic classification system.

The species is combined with the Rhytiphora genus ranked in the Pteropliini tribe of Lamiinae.
